WebApr 12, 2024 · New Industrial Real Estate Development Activity in Washington, D.C. in Q4 2024. The construction pipeline brought over 790,000 square feet of industrial space online for Washington, D.C.’s market. One of those deliveries was Capital Electric’s 362,880-square-foot expansion . Completions for 2024 reached 2.3 million square feet of new product.
